hey guys

bit of a background for you...

i am 18 years old been trainin about a year now my first month or so was jus jumping between machines and had no diet so cant really count them as training months i guess!
i was about 8stone10 when i started so obviosally i was very very small a year on and i am about 11 stone 10 so iv gained well so far, my diet hasnt been great but iv kept the protein high, but i do believe i am lacking many things in my diet.


my training programme:

Tuesday: Legs

Squat: 3x10
leg extenstion: 3x10
hamstring curl: 3x10
Calf raises 3x20

Wednesday:Chest/Tri


Bench : 3x10
Flyes : 3x10
Dips:3x10
Tricep Pushdown:3x10

Friday:Delt/Bicep

Dumbell Press 3x10
Upright Row 3x10
Shrugs 3x10
Barbell Curl 3x10
Crossover machine Curl 3x10

Sunday:Back

Chins 3x failure
Deadlift 3x10 {when i can}
Barbell Row 3x10



Right here's the diet

7:30

100g oats
2 eggs
1 tbsp nut oil
1Tbsp flaxseed oil
500 ml Milk
Banana
30g whey

10:30

50g peanut butter + 2 whole meal bread + apple

1:30 and 4:00

700 ml milk
40g of choc nesquik powder
180g oats
2 Tbsp Nut oil
1 Tbsp Flaxseed oil
60g whey

6:30

1 tin tuna or 100g chicken or 100beef
Dollop of natural low fat yoghurt
Lemon juice
2 wholemeal bread
Salad

9:30

3 egg omelette 1 slice of granary bread

Post Workout

50g whey
60g dextrose
